A New Crew, A New Mission: Understanding Crew-10
Crew-10 represents the tenth operational crewed mission to the ISS under NASA's Commercial Crew Program. This program leverages the capabilities of private companies, like SpaceX, to transport astronauts to and from the orbiting laboratory. The mission promises to be packed with scientific research, technological advancements, and crucial maintenance tasks on the ISS. The crew is comprised of experienced astronauts from various backgrounds, representing a global effort in space exploration.
Key Mission Objectives:
- Conducting Scientific Experiments: A wide array of scientific research experiments will be conducted in microgravity, covering various fields including biology, physics, and materials science.
- ISS Maintenance and Upgrades: The crew will be responsible for essential maintenance and upgrades to the ISS infrastructure, ensuring its continued operation.
- Spacewalks (EVAs): Possibility of spacewalks to perform critical tasks outside the space station.
- Technological Demonstrations: Testing and demonstration of new technologies vital for future space missions.

The Significance of Public-Private Partnerships in Space Exploration
The Crew-10 mission underscores the success of the public-private partnership model in space exploration. By collaborating with private companies like SpaceX, NASA is able to efficiently and effectively achieve its ambitious goals while also fostering innovation and competition in the aerospace industry. This model allows for greater flexibility and cost-effectiveness compared to solely government-led missions.
